‘I think we’ll see a separate subscription’: Apple could lock the best parts of Siri AI behind a ChatGPT-style paywall, tipster predicts



  • Siri’s AI overhaul is currently free, but a reputable source predicts that Apple will add a subscription eventually
  • This will probably lock off advanced features like conversational responses and image generation, while basics remain free
  • Before that, Apple will probably want to improve its AI model and convince people that it’s worth using

Perhaps one of the biggest surprises of WWDC 2026 was that Apple didn’t announce any subscription plans for its long-awaited Siri AI overhaul. Rival services like Gemini, ChatGPT, and Claude hide their best models and features behind a paywall, but Apple isn’t following that trend just yet — however, this generosity might not last forever.

Reputable Apple tipster Mark Gurman has argued in his latest Bloomberg newsletter (via PhoneArena) that a subscription fee probably will be coming to Siri — but not yet, and not for everything.

Gurman predicts that Apple will keep all the previously existing Siri features free, along with its new on-device personal context capabilities for searching through messages and calendar entries, but that he thinks “we’ll see a separate subscription at some point” for things like conversational responses and image generation.
